Visual Characteristics and Style
Colibri has a handcrafted feel with elegant curves and expressive strokes. Its whimsical nature makes it ideal for creative projects where personality matters. The font blends modern typography with a touch of artistry, offering a balance between readability and style.
While it may not be suited for long blocks of text, Colibri shines in short phrases, headlines, and decorative accents. Its visual appeal works well for hero sections, call-to-action buttons, and branding elements that need to stand out.

Readability and Layout Rhythm
Despite its decorative nature, Colibri maintains a level of readability that works well in digital environments. However, it's best used sparingly and in larger sizes to ensure legibility on both desktop and mobile screens.
When designing for responsive layouts, consider how Colibri interacts with different screen sizes. For smaller buttons or text overlays, use it cautiously to avoid clutter and maintain a clean layout rhythm.
For dark backgrounds or image overlays, test Colibri's contrast to ensure it remains visible and doesn’t compromise the overall design.
Font Pairing and Brand Identity
Font pairing is essential in creating a cohesive visual identity. Colibri pairs well with simple sans serif fonts like Helvetica or Arial for body copy, ensuring a clear distinction between decorative and functional typography.
If your brand has an editorial or more refined tone, consider pairing Colibri with a serif font for a balanced and professional look. This combination can help establish a strong brand identity while maintaining readability across all content types.
